    Sliding glass door threshold seems too high.

    The 2012 code commentary for that section states that the 7 3/4" can be above both the inside and outside floor surface/landing. They do acknowledge that it could be a tripping hazard, and that way of building not a common practice. Based on the IRC I would say that the installation is code...

    Exit Access Travel Distance to Exit #2 - Any limit?

    although only somewhat related, Chicago has issued a clarification about this issue (only applicable in Chicago of course) stating the same fact, that the distance is measured to only one of the required exits, and the travel distance to other required exits is essentially unlimited.
